PHP gevorderde |
|
hey, ik heb op dit volgende problemen heel lang geprobeert en gepiekert maar ik kom er maar niet uit.
misschien weet 1 van jullie hoe het moet.
wat heb ik
de gebruikers kunnen UBB invoeren bij het posten van een bericht.
dit bericht wordt in een functie van alle opmaak voorzien. (dik gedrukt, schuin, quote, img ect..)
waar zit het probleem
als je een url toevoeg voor een plaatje ( [img]hier url[/img] ) en het plaatje is groter dan me tekstvlak dan gaat me layout kapot.
Mogenlijke oplossing
Ik dacht dus, als ik de url van het plaatje kan opslaan in een variabele dan kan ik het plaatje verkleinen als dat nodig is.
de vraag
hoe krijg ik die url in een variabele?
deze code gebruik ik: (niet zelf geschreven)
<?php
$txt = preg_replace("/\[img\](.*?)\[\/img\]/si", "<!-- BBCode Start --><img src=\"\\1\" border=\"0\" /><!-- BBCode End -->", $txt);
?>
<?php $txt = preg_replace("/\[img\](.*?)\[\/img\]/si", "<!-- BBCode Start --><img src=\"\\1\" border=\"0\" /><!-- BBCode End -->", $txt); ?>
wie kan mij helpen de url van het plaatje op te slaan in een variabele?
Grtz
|